Subject: Partner SFTP drop — tonight's Bramblehurst delivery

Team, the nightly Bramblehurst partner drop lands on the SFTP gateway at 02:00 UTC. On-call: please confirm the ingest job picks up all three manifest files and that checksums match before acknowledging. If any file is missing, hold the release and page data-eng rather than re-running manually. The expected payload was produced by the following build.

build token for kagaf-hahof: htk14_9d3d4d26d7d8de

# Artifact Signing: Report Export Service

All report exports from the Clockvale service embed a UTC generation timestamp; local-timezone conversion happens only at render time, never in the stored artifact. Because timezone tables change, each export bundle pins the tzdata version it used, and the bundle is signed so reviewers can confirm the pinned version was not altered post-export. Verification of existing bundles uses the signing key below.

signing key of bagap-yawep = bky13_TbfT6ZMUoGJo2

**FAQ: Why do payment retries need idempotency keys?**

Good question from the security side. Our Tillgate checkout can retry a charge after a network blip, and without idempotency keys we'd double-bill people. Each retry reuses the original key, so the ledger service treats it as the same attempt. If the key vault itself gets wedged during an audit, you can reopen it with the passphrase below.

vault phrase of tafop-yawep = rusdor-gorvan-zordor-istox-fenael-holael

Welcome to on-call for the Glimmerpane design system! Our snapshot tests live in the `snapcheck` suite and run on every merge to main. If a UI component changes visually, the diff bot flags it — usually it's an intentional tweak, so just approve the new baseline. If it's 2am and snapshots are failing across the board, it's almost always a font-loading race, not your problem. To unlock the baseline store and re-approve snapshots in bulk, use the recovery passphrase below.

recovery phrase for tahag-taguf: wenix-caswyn